Summary

Dr. Rhonda Mough is an internal medicine physician who brings 25 years of experience to her practice. She earned her medical degree from the University of Pittsburgh School of Medicine and completed her residency at George Washington University Hospital. Her extensive background in internal medicine positions her to provide comprehensive primary care for adult patients.

Dr. Mough practices at Wilmington Health Internal Medicine in Wilmington, NC, and maintains an affiliation with Abie Abraham VA Clinic. She specializes in treating conditions such as allergies and allergic rhinitis, helping patients manage seasonal and environmental sensitivities. Her expertise also includes addressing obesity and weight management concerns. Dr. Mough performs procedures including allergen immunotherapy and sublingual immunotherapy to help patients build tolerance to allergens, as well as complete blood count testing for diagnostic purposes.
